安全性是开发一对一直播软件源码时需要格外注意的一项系统性能,为确保系统安全性,我们通常会采取多种安全防护机制,除此之外,加强对系统权限的管理,在一定程度上也可以降低安全风险,在开发一对一直播软件源码时,要将权限管理落实到细节。
今天我们主要就基于角色的权限访问控制进行分析,在该权限管理模式下,用户、角色、权限是非常重要的三个要素,接下来我们就各个要素的管理进行详细分析。
一、用户管理
这里的用户是指使用一对一直播软件源码的每一个人,我们要结合实际的业务场景或功能架构来构建完善的用户管理系统。
二、角色管理
在一对一直播软件源码中,系统角色需要基于实际的业务场景进行设计,一般角色对于用户来说是固定不变的,每一个角色都有其对应的权限和限制。
为了确保系统权限管理的灵活性,可以设置一些临时角色,让临时角色使用临时的权限,,当然在设置临时角色时要制定好失效时间,一旦失效就得重新启用,以此在优化用户使用体验的同时降低一对一直播软件源码中的安全隐患。
三、权限管理
在开发一对一直播软件源码时,权限管理涉及三个方面,分别是页面/菜单权限、操作权限和数据权限。
1、页面/菜单权限
为方便进行权限管理,对于没有权限操作的用户,可以直接将一对一直播软件源码中对应的页面入口和菜单选项隐藏起来。
2、操作权限
主要是指不同的用户可能用对对同一组数据的不同处理权限,有些用户只能阅读,有些用户却可以更改。
3、数据权限
在一对一直播软件源码开发时,我们可以通过在数据接口上做限制的方式来实现更高安全需求的权限管理。数据权限可分为两种,分别是控制看多少条数据的行权限和控制看一条数据多少字段的列权限。做好数据权限管理对于加强一对一直播软件源码的权限管理而言非常关键。
在一对一直播软件源码运行过程中会面临各种各样的安全问题,只有加强系统安全性管理,才能提供更安全的服务。云豹一对一直播软件源码为预防多种安全风险采用了多种安全防护机制,系统的安全性、可用性更有保障,如有需要可联系客服进行咨询。